AKELA Incorporated is a locally owned, Santa Barbara based, developer and manufacturer of radar systems and equipment for defense, law enforcement, and security applications. We are a small business focused on manufacturing high quality systems and equipment that fulfill unique and challenging customer requirements. AKELA provides a team focused, positive work environment where individual contributions are recognized and rewarded. Our radar systems range from small hand held self contained sensors, to large vehicle mounted MIMO arrays. RF / Analog DESIGN ENGINEER
AKELA is seeking results driven, self motivated individuals who work well in small teams or independently. The successful candidate will be part of a team contributing to radar system design and will be directly responsible for design and development of subsystems from start to finish, starting with circuit design, circuit analysis, schematic capture, and circuit board layout; proceeding to system integration, test, and trouble shooting; and finishing with system performance verification, and field testing.
BSEE/MSEE with 3+ years experience in industry with a track record of completed designs and demonstrated problem solving abilities.
Candidate must possess many of the following skills and experience with:
- Radar and radar signal processing principles
- Thorough understanding of gain distribution and dynamic range principle and practices
- RF and microwave experience IF to 6 GHz required, higher frequency experience desirable
- Wide band multi-octave, multi-decade RF design
- A/D converter implementation for high dynamic range
- Digital Down Conversion
- Analog IF strips including filters and gain controls
- RF low noise high dynamic range amplifier design
- RF Medium Power Amplifier design
- Low noise high bandwidth Phase Locked Loop frequency synthesizers
- Direct Digital Synthesis
- Block up and down converters
- Digital circuitry and interfaces supporting RF electronics
Candidates must be available for travel to participate in system field testing at remote locations within the U.S.
